Job Description

Job Description Summary

The Project Manager – Government Services will serve as the primary point of contact with specific critical customers. Responsibilities include project planning/execution/monitoring & controlling, coordination of engineering and subcontract resources, and issues resolution with a focus on customer satisfaction, On Time Delivery (OTD) and revenue/CM growth. You will report to the Marine Services leader and manage the day-to-day execution of multiple, concurrent projects.

Job Description

Essential Responsibilities :
As the Project Manager – Government Services you will:

  • Plan, coordinate and execute design, build and installation support activities across GE and subcontracted resources ensuring that work is completed within the requirements of the contract and ensuring cost, quality and schedule constraints are met or exceeded
  • Identify, manage and execute day-to-day operational aspects of project scope while adapting to changing needs and requirements of the customer
  • Maintain accurate project milestone accuracy creating visible and predictable data for key business metrics and revenue forecasting
  • Accountable for the project revenue, contribution margin and cash collection targets in support of the PC North America region. Support day to day operations including QMI reviews, project reviews, CMR reviews, one OTR process and regional reviews
  • Regular tracking and communication of project progress, open action items and all aspects of project status to key stakeholders including project kick-off, regular status updates, risks and opportunities and project closure
  • Identification, escalation and resolution of issue/risks which might affect customer satisfaction and GE operational targets
  • Be a self-motivated team player who can drive cross-functional teams and communicate the results effectively to customers


Qualifications/Requirements :

  • Bachelor’s degree in Business Management or related field from an accredited university or college
  • Minimum 8 years of experience in a project management, engineering or manufacturing role and/or working in a lead capacity implementing projects in a field environment
